Begin your journey with the Mary Queen of Scots Tour and immerse yourself in the life of one of Scotland’s most enigmatic figures. This private tour offers an exclusive glimpse into the palaces and residences that Mary, Queen of Scots, once called home. With a kilted guide leading the way, you’ll explore Linlithgow Palace, the birthplace of Mary, and Stirling Castle, where she was crowned Queen of Scots at just nine months old.

The tour is a luxurious experience, with private transportation in a spacious Mercedes MPV, ensuring comfort as you traverse the Scottish countryside. As you pass through the charming village of Falkland, known for its role in the ‘Outlander’ series, you’ll catch your first glimpse of Falkland Palace. This royal hunting lodge was a favorite retreat of Mary, who enjoyed its gardens and engaged in falconry, hunting, and tennis. The palace boasts the world’s oldest surviving royal tennis court, where Mary once played, offering a tangible connection to the past.

The Historic Castles Tour provides an opportunity to delve deeper into the life of Mary, Queen of Scots, through both history and cinema. Explore Craigmillar Castle, where Mary sought refuge and conspired with her nobles, and Linlithgow Palace, where her early life unfolded.

Stirling Castle, another highlight of the tour, offers a glimpse into Mary’s childhood and preparation for queenship. The royal apartments, rich with history, showcase the early education of one of Scotland’s most famous monarchs. As you wander through these historic sites, the stories of intrigue, romance, and betrayal come to life, painting a vivid picture of Mary’s extraordinary, albeit tragic, life.
